## Abstract A new tripeptide, L‐α‐aminoadipyl‐L‐seryl‐D‐valine has been synthesized by coupling the protected L‐seryl‐D‐valine dipeptide with an appropriately protected L‐α‐aminoadipic acid ester. The free tripeptide was obtained after treatment with liquid HF and purification by HPLC.
